Do Puppies feel unwell after vaccinations?
Will vaccination make my dog sick? Some dogs develop mild lethargy or soreness 1 to 2 days after vaccination. In the case of killed vaccines containing an adjuvant, lump formation may occur at the vaccination site.
Can puppies have side effects from vaccinations?
The majority of reactions are mild and short lived. If you suspect a more severe reaction to puppy vaccines or dog vaccines, such as facial swelling, vomiting or lethargy, you should contact your veterinarian immediately.
Can dog vaccines have side effects?
The most common vaccine reactions in dogs are lethargy and soreness, which may or may not be combined with a mild fever. This occurs because the dog’s immune system reacts both locally and systemically to vaccine administration. Prompting the immune system to respond is the whole point of vaccination.

Why is my dog shaking after getting shots?
A few may seem a little lethargic, wanting to sleep more for approximately twenty-four hours after the vaccination. Occasionally an animal may have an allergic reaction, with symptoms ranging from mild (shivering, shaking, perhaps vomiting) to severe (facial swelling, congestion, difficulty breathing).

Is it normal for a dog to be in pain after shots?
It is not unusual for a pet to be quiet and uncomfortable for up to 24 hours after a vaccination. There may be localized or generalized pain, lethargy (diminished activity or decrease in social behavior), loss of appetite, mild swelling at the injection site, or even a low/mild fever associated with the shots.
Do dogs feel bad after rabies shot?
Common Side Effects of Rabies Vaccine in Dogs Side effects can include mild fever, mild loss of appetite and mild to moderate loss of energy for 24 to 36 hours after vaccination. It’s also possible for dogs to experience soreness and mild swelling at the injection site.

Can I give my dog Benadryl after vaccinations?
Is Benadryl Safe for Dogs? Benadryl is safe for dogs. The active ingredient, diphenhydramine, is used in veterinary formulations that are FDA approved. Veterinarians may recommend Benadryl to their clients whose pets have allergic reactions to vaccines or other medications.
